云计算,作为分布式计算的一种,以网络化为基础,代表着计算技术的发展趋势。它不仅扩展了分布式计算的应用范围,更预示着未来计算模式的革新。
本文目录导读:
图片来源于网络,如有侵权联系删除
随着信息技术的飞速发展,云计算已成为当今世界信息技术领域的重要发展方向,云计算以其高效、便捷、灵活的特点,逐渐成为企业、政府和个人用户的重要选择,而云计算的核心技术——分布式计算,更是支撑着云计算的快速发展,本文将从分布式计算的概念、特点、应用及未来展望等方面进行探讨。
分布式计算的概念
分布式计算是一种将计算任务分配到多个计算机上,通过高速网络实现协同处理的技术,在分布式计算中,每台计算机被称为节点,节点之间通过网络进行通信和协作,与传统的集中式计算相比,分布式计算具有更高的并行性、可扩展性和可靠性。
分布式计算的特点
1、并行性:分布式计算可以充分利用网络中的多台计算机资源,实现任务的并行处理,从而提高计算效率。
2、可扩展性:分布式计算可以根据需要动态地增加或减少节点,以适应不同规模的任务需求。
3、可靠性:分布式计算通过节点之间的冗余设计,提高了系统的容错能力,降低了系统故障对计算任务的影响。
4、灵活性:分布式计算可以根据实际需求,灵活地调整计算资源,降低成本。
分布式计算的应用
1、云计算:分布式计算是云计算的核心技术之一,通过分布式计算,云计算可以提供高性能、高可靠性的计算服务。
图片来源于网络,如有侵权联系删除
2、大数据:分布式计算在处理海量数据方面具有显著优势,可以有效地进行数据挖掘、分析和处理。
3、物联网:分布式计算在物联网领域具有广泛的应用,如智能家居、智能交通等。
4、生物信息学:分布式计算在生物信息学领域具有重要作用,可以加速基因组测序、药物研发等任务。
分布式计算的挑战与展望
1、挑战
(1)数据传输:分布式计算中,节点之间的数据传输成为制约计算效率的重要因素。
(2)安全性:分布式计算涉及到大量敏感数据,如何保障数据安全成为一大挑战。
(3)资源管理:分布式计算中,如何高效地管理和调度计算资源成为一大难题。
图片来源于网络,如有侵权联系删除
2、展望
(1)高速网络:随着5G、6G等高速网络的推广,分布式计算的数据传输速度将得到大幅提升。
(2)人工智能:人工智能技术将应用于分布式计算,实现智能资源调度和优化。
(3)边缘计算:边缘计算将分布式计算延伸至网络边缘,提高计算效率和实时性。
分布式计算作为云计算的基石,在当今信息技术领域具有举足轻重的地位,随着技术的不断发展,分布式计算将在更多领域发挥重要作用,为人类创造更加美好的未来。
评论列表